* test(scripts): re-exclude Windows-incompatible workflow tests on win32
Re-add pr-self-report-label.test.js and qwen-pr-review-workflow.test.js to
the win32 exclude list. Both fail on a Windows runner for reasons the code
still carries: qwen-pr-review-workflow.test.js calls execFileSync('mkdir'),
which has no executable to resolve there, and pr-self-report-label.test.js
joins PATH with ':', corrupting the ';'-separated Windows PATH so its gh
stub never resolves. Excluding them restores a green Windows gate; Linux CI
remains their authoritative coverage. Document the criterion inline.

* fix(ci): make SIGTERM escalation test Windows-aware and tighten pins (#8386)
The CDP acceptance test asserted a POSIX-only SIGKILL escalation, which
fails deterministically on Windows where kill('SIGTERM') terminates the
child directly — blocking the Windows merge-queue gate. Assert the
platform-appropriate signal instead.
